The village of Jocotepec ("place of the plum trees) is 470 years
old. It is the country seat (municipio)
for a number of smaller surrounding towns. Historically home to
fisherman, farmers and shopkeepers, our village has also become so
famous for its hardworking and talented brick masons that contractors
come to hire them from as far away as Acapulco! If you'd like to get
the flavor, sights, sounds, aromas of daily life in a typical Mexican
pueblo, this is the place!

Authentic, unspoiled Jocotepec boasts a colorful market, bustling
street activity, and modestly priced restaurants. At the village square
or "plaza"
you may get a spiffy shoeshine while watching the passing scene.
Late afternoon is a lovely quiet time. Hundreds of birds arrive, first
perching in orderly sunset rows on the town hall facade, then settling
into the surrounding trees for their nightly slumber.
Small restaurants in the arcades surrounding the plaza are famous for their "birria", a tasty goat stew, that goes perfectly with one of Mexico's popular beers. Thursdays the "tianguis",
or street market is a lively destination for tooled and stitched
leather belts, silver jewelry, and the freshest garden produce.

Sunday nights, after 8:00 mass,the plaza truly comes to life with street stands selling yummy local treats: tacos "al pastor", tamales, "churros" (long skinny donuts), fresh potato chips, or hot steamed garbanzo beans. You may also join the Sunday night "paseo", a centuries old courting ritual , where Se�oritas and Se�ores stroll in opposing circles, flirting and tossing confetti, while watchful parents keep tabs from their sideline benches.
